(Cambria) prepared this document as the San Joaquin County Environmental <br /> Health Department(SJCEHD)requested in their September 15,2005 letter to Shell. In this letter, <br /> SJCEHD requested a work plan for installing the remediation system proposed in Cambria's <br /> September 9, 2005 Corrective Action Plan and Risk-Based Corrective Action Analysis. SJCEHD <br /> specifically requested that the work plan include installation details of proposed extraction wells, <br /> design details and diagrams for the proposed remediation system, plans for disposal of extracted <br /> groundwater,and a calculation of contaminant mass remaining in both soil and groundwater. <br /> SITE BACKGROUND <br /> Site Location and Description <br /> The site is an active Shell-branded service station located on the southwest corner of the Pacific <br /> Avenue and Porter Avenue intersection in a mixed commercial and residential area of Stockton, <br /> California (Figure 1).
